I genuinely like the N64 controller. I know it looks weird and represents an absolute dead-end in design but it's also worth remembering it was the first major console controller with an analogue stick -- the PS1 didn't get one until 97 -- and it was in the extremely early days of 3D games. So Nintendo chose a layout that was good for their flagship 3D game, Mario 64. Which made sense at launch but did rather bite them in the bum as the 90s rolled on and we ended up trying to play Goldeneye and Perfect Dark with the C pad as a kind of proxy right-hand analogue stick.
